You may be eligible for Hazardous Duty Pay without also being eligible for a "combat patch."
The Army combat patch, officially known as the "shoulder sleeve insignia-former wartime service" (SSI-FWTS), recognizes soldiers' participation in combat operations.
While stationed in Kuwair 95 to 96, I received Hazardous Duty Pay, but were not authorized "combat patches."
Almost every single Army regulation is online. The most dangerous individual in any service is one who knows and understands the regs.

No they didn't get rid of anything. You can be deployed to a combat zone without actually being in combat. CIB and CAB are for those actually underfire by an enemy combatant. A combat patch is for being deployed to that combat zone. I was deployed all over the world. Doesn't mean I get a shoulder patch every time I deployed
